Possible Causes of Basement Flooding in College Station

Basement flooding can happen unexpectedly and is often caused by heavy rainfall or storms that overwhelm drainage systems. When the ground becomes saturated, water can seep through cracks or poorly sealed basement walls, leading to significant water accumulation. Sometimes, a lack of proper gutters and downspouts can contribute to water pooling around the foundation, increasing the risk of flooding.

Another common cause is plumbing failures, such as burst pipes or leaking appliances, which can quickly flood a basement and cause extensive water damage. Additionally, issues like sewer backups or groundwater pressure due to nearby construction can also lead to basement flooding. Identifying the root cause of the water intrusion is essential to prevent future incidents and ensure a thorough cleanup process.

How We Can Fix Flooded Basement Problems

Our team begins with a detailed assessment to determine the extent of the water damage and identify the source of flooding. We use advanced moisture detection tools to locate hidden water pockets, ensuring no area is overlooked. Once the assessment is complete, we develop a customized plan tailored to your specific needs, prioritizing safety and efficiency.

We then proceed with water extraction using industrial-grade pumps and vacuums to remove standing water quickly. Following extraction, our experts focus on drying and dehumidifying the affected areas with high-powered equipment designed to prevent mold growth and further structural damage. We also sanitize and disinfect all surfaces to restore a safe, healthy environment within your basement.

Throughout the restoration process, our team works diligently to minimize disruption to your home. We handle plumbing repairs if needed, seal foundation cracks, and implement waterproofing measures to reduce future flooding risks.
